Inhaled corticosteroid treatment and pneumonia in patients with chronic obstructive pulmonary disease – nationwide development from 1998 to 2018
Background A decreasing use of inhaled corticosteroids (ICS) in patients with a hospital-registered diagnosis of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) has recently been documented in Denmark.
